4.3BSD/usr/guest/karels/tests/sockname.c
#include <stdio.h>
#include <sys/types.h>
#include <sys/socket.h>
#include <netinet/in.h>
#include <netdb.h>
main()
{
int s;
struct sockaddr_in address;
s = socket(AF_INET, SOCK_DGRAM, 0);
if (s == -1) {
perror("socket");
exit(1);
}
bzero(&address, sizeof(struct sockaddr_in));
address.sin_family = AF_INET;
if (bind(s, &address, sizeof(struct sockaddr_in)) == -1) {
perror("bind");
exit(1);
}
printhostname(s);
}
printhostname(s)
int s;
{
int n;
char buf[100];
struct hostent *hp;
n = sizeof(buf);;
if (getsockname(s, buf, &n) == -1) {
perror("getsockname");
exit(1);
}
printf("name is :%s:\n",buf);
/*
* Now check that the address is valid.
*/
hp = gethostbyaddr(buf, n, AF_INET);
if (hp == 0)
printf("Address not found.\n");
else
printf("%s\n", hp->h_name);
}
